It is now a fact that pizza can be enjoyed as part of a balanced diet, providing you remember two key things when creating or ordering your pizza.
1) There are many low fat cheeses out there to try and although some may taste extremely different when eaten straight from their packets, they actually taste great when oven baked on a pizza. Shop around and select the best low fat cheese for you.
2) The pizza dough is another obstacle for many, as this can be very thick and bloating. Using a medium or thick base, but then simply removing some of the dough in the center, can really reduce the calories of the pizza. Try removing the dough in the center (hollowing the dough base slightly) and then filling this with thinly chopped salad, to create a healthy and compact base. Of course, if you feel like making your dough from scratch, simply use less dough and make the center of the base more hollow.
Once your low fat cheese has been sprinkled over and your meats placed, you’ll have a low fat and delicious pizza to enjoy without dreading the scales. We’ll be bringing you more on what low fat cheeses to use, very soon.
